The Real Deal: Our Unique Challenges
South Africa sits pretty at the tip of Africa, perfectly positioned for global trade. But let's not sugar-coat it - getting your products from our shores to international customers comes with its fair share of curve balls:
Road Blocks and Speed Bumps
Think our potholes are bad? The reality of cross-border logistics throws even bigger challenges your way. Congested border posts, varying infrastructure quality, and the occasional systems offline at customs can turn a simple delivery into an adventure worthy of a reality show.The Paper Chase
Each country has its own rulebook, and sometimes it feels like they're written in hieroglyphics. One minute you're cruising with your documentation, the next you're stuck because someone needs a form you've never heard of - in triplicate.- Tech That's Playing Catch-Up
While the rest of the world is going digital at lightning speed, some of our regional systems are still taking the scenic route. It's like trying to use a Nokia 3310 in a smartphone world.

Smart Solutions for Savvy Business Owners
Now for the good news - there are ways to turn these challenges into opportunities:
Go Digital or Go Home
This isn't just about having a fancy website. Modern tracking systems, cloud-based management tools, and automated customs documentation are your new best mates. They're like having a GPS for your business - showing you exactly where you're going and how to get there faster.
Build Your A-Team
Partner with people who know their stuff. Local customs agents who can speak the language (literally and figuratively) of each border post. Transport companies who know which routes avoid the drama. These partnerships are worth their weight in gold.
Plan for Murphy's Law
In South Africa, we know a thing or two about expecting the unexpected (load shedding, anyone?). Apply this mindset to your logistics:
Have backup routes mapped out
Keep emergency contacts on speed dial
Stay updated on border situations
Keep some buffer stock for those "just in case" moments
Tech That Makes Life Easier
Digital Integration
Your online store should talk seamlessly with your shipping systems. Modern APIs connect everything from your shopping cart to tracking updates, making it easier than a tap-and-go payment.
Customer-First Solutions
Make it dead simple for international customers to buy from you:
Show delivery costs upfront in their currency
Handle customs duties on your end
Offer hassle-free returns
Provide tracking updates in their language and time zone
